Produktbeschreibung
In this journey of *Kavya Tarani* (Poetry Boat), I have encapsulated a variety of emotions. Some are influenced by the surroundings, while others arise from the depths of my own heart-our traditions, beliefs, love, deceit, and more. All of these have an impact on the human heart. When these feelings touch the heart, the pen begins its journey. This is a voyage from one heart to another. We all know that no moment is ever the same. Sometimes we are happy, sometimes sorrowful; sometimes our sleep is disturbed, sometimes we are soaked in faith. These are all parts of our lives. This writing will surely touch your heart because our hearts are similar; we all go through different emotions, and each emotion holds significance for others. When you read, you will understand it close to your own heart. My poems are regularly published in newspapers, and readers appreciate and enjoy them. It is this encouragement that motivates me, and with this encouragement, I have mustered the courage to publish my third solo poetry collection. -Geeta Agarwal (Author)

Autorenporträt
Poetess, writer and editor Geeta Agarwal was born on 27 December in Bikaner district of Rajasthan. Presently, she is the President of Agarwal Samaj, Gachi Baoli, Women's Wing Branch. The author has been working in the education sector for many years and is currently active in social work. Her literary works have been published in many anthologies.
